What will I experience with quitting Suboxone cold turkey?

What will I experience with quitting Suboxone cold turkey? I have been on Suboxone for about a year and currently take four milligrams a day. I can't afford to keep up with this habit and want to feel normal again. I've got three 8 milligram films left and want to use them wisely if this gets too devastating. I have a five year old son and a job as well as other responsibilities and I guess it'd be good to note that I suffer from depression. Thanks in advance. I really want to make this a late New Years resolution.

My doctor and many others suggest .5mgs before quitting. 4 mgs is like 160mgs of morphine, but leaves the body 3 times slower. Tapering down low will not stop withdrawals or how long they last, in my experience and observation, but reduces the symptoms a lot. Amino acids, multivitamin, Cal/mag/zinc, and EmergenC helped me most for reducing symptoms and increasing healing time. Drink lots of water and get Epsom salts for baths as hot as you can possibly stand it. Many have jumped at 4mgs, it can be done. Because of depression and responsibility, it is common practice to do a slow calculated taper, skipping a day and two days at the lowest final dose. I feel your chances of of success would in erase tremendously, and you only want to do this once, right? Keep hanging around and you will get plenty of opinions to choose from, especially with subs, but most agree, taper as low as you can. Keep us posted.

Don't jump off that high of a dose! I did it 19 days ago and I'm only just now feeling slightly better.  I had restless legs, insomnia, anxiety, my entire body shook and I felt like total **** up until today! Please listen and taper down as low as u can. I wasn't smart and am paying for it, don't be a dummy like me lol. Wish you The best of luck!!!!!!
